Why is the Earth's Rotation Slowing Down?


The Earth's rotation speed may feel constant, but it fluctuates because of various natural phenomena. Earthquakes, volcanoes, tidal forces, and wind patterns can all influence the speed at which our planet rotates. However, a new study suggests that mass redistribution from the poles to the world's oceans, mainly because of polar ice melt, significantly contributes to the slowing down of Earth's rotation.


The Impact of Polar Ice Melting

The melting of polar ice caps because of global warming has led to mass redistribution around the Earth. As ice melts, the water flows into the oceans, causing a shift in the Earth's mass distribution. This mass redistribution affects the Earth's rotation by changing its moment of inertia, decreasing its rotational speed.


The Delay of Leap Second Deletion

The slowing down of the Earth's rotation because of polar ice melt has a significant impact on timekeeping. It is delaying a historic event—the deletion of a leap second. Leap seconds are added to Coordinated Universal Time (UTC) to account for irregularities in the Earth's rotation. However, with the Earth's rotation slowing down, the need for leap seconds may decrease, eventually leading to the first-ever deletion of a leap second in history.


The Role of Climate Change

Climate change, driven by human activities such as burning fossil fuels and deforestation, has accelerated the melting of polar ice caps. This rapid ice melt exacerbates mass redistribution, slowing the Earth's rotation. We can expect further changes in Earth's rotation speed if current trends continue.
